How to Backup your Firefox bookmarks

How to Backup Your Bookmarks Manually

From the Firefox menu bar go to Bookmarks   Organize Bookmarks to bring up your bookmarks manager.  Now you want to click the top button that says Import and Backup.

Next, select Backup.  This will bring up a “Save As” box where you can save your bookmarks to any location.  Make sure you leave the bookmark as a .json file too.  Since Firefox 3, this is the type of file Firefox uses for backups.  If you wish to export your bookmarks as an HTML file, go to Import and Backup Export HTML.  That will give you the more traditional .html backup.
